3. Add/drop
The add/drop period is an important part of the UCF fall 2025 calendar. It gives students the flexibility to adjust their schedules during the first few weeks of the semester. This can be helpful for students who need to add a class to meet their graduation requirements, or for students who need to drop a class because it is too difficult or conflicts with their other commitments.
The add/drop period typically lasts for the first two weeks of the semester. During this time, students can add or drop classes without penalty. However, students should be aware that some classes may have restrictions on when they can be added or dropped. For example, some classes may not be available to be added after the first week of the semester. Students should also be aware that they may be responsible for paying tuition and fees for any classes that they add during the add/drop period.
The add/drop period is a valuable opportunity for students to make sure that their schedules are meeting their needs. Students should use this time to carefully consider their course options and to make any necessary changes.
